| namespace blink { |
| |
| TEST(BisonCSSParserTest, ParseAnimationTimingFunctionValue) |
| { |
| RefPtr<CSSValue> timingFunctionValue; |
| timingFunctionValue = BisonCSSParser::parseAnimationTimingFunctionValue("ease"); |
| EXPECT_EQ(CSSValueEase, toCSSPrimitiveValue(timingFunctionValue.get())->getValueID()); |
| |
| timingFunctionValue = BisonCSSParser::parseAnimationTimingFunctionValue("linear"); |
| EXPECT_EQ(CSSValueLinear, toCSSPrimitiveValue(timingFunctionValue.get())->getValueID()); |
| |
| timingFunctionValue = BisonCSSParser::parseAnimationTimingFunctionValue("ease-in"); |
| EXPECT_EQ(CSSValueEaseIn, toCSSPrimitiveValue(timingFunctionValue.get())->getValueID()); |
| |
| timingFunctionValue = BisonCSSParser::parseAnimationTimingFunctionValue("ease-out"); |
| EXPECT_EQ(CSSValueEaseOut, toCSSPrimitiveValue(timingFunctionValue.get())->getValueID()); |
| |
| timingFunctionValue = BisonCSSParser::parseAnimationTimingFunctionValue("ease-in-out"); |
| EXPECT_EQ(CSSValueEaseInOut, toCSSPrimitiveValue(timingFunctionValue.get())->getValueID()); |
| |
| timingFunctionValue = BisonCSSParser::parseAnimationTimingFunctionValue("step-start"); |
| EXPECT_EQ(CSSValueStepStart, toCSSPrimitiveValue(timingFunctionValue.get())->getValueID()); |
| |
| timingFunctionValue = BisonCSSParser::parseAnimationTimingFunctionValue("step-middle"); |
| EXPECT_EQ(CSSValueStepMiddle, toCSSPrimitiveValue(timingFunctionValue.get())->getValueID()); |
| |
| timingFunctionValue = BisonCSSParser::parseAnimationTimingFunctionValue("step-end"); |
| EXPECT_EQ(CSSValueStepEnd, toCSSPrimitiveValue(timingFunctionValue.get())->getValueID()); |
| |
| timingFunctionValue = BisonCSSParser::parseAnimationTimingFunctionValue("steps(3, start)"); |
| EXPECT_TRUE(CSSStepsTimingFunctionValue::create(3, StepsTimingFunction::StepAtStart)->equals(toCSSStepsTimingFunctionValue(*timingFunctionValue.get()))); |
| |
| timingFunctionValue = BisonCSSParser::parseAnimationTimingFunctionValue("steps(3, middle)"); |
| EXPECT_TRUE(CSSStepsTimingFunctionValue::create(3, StepsTimingFunction::StepAtMiddle)->equals(toCSSStepsTimingFunctionValue(*timingFunctionValue.get()))); |
| |
| timingFunctionValue = BisonCSSParser::parseAnimationTimingFunctionValue("steps(3, end)"); |
| EXPECT_TRUE(CSSStepsTimingFunctionValue::create(3, StepsTimingFunction::StepAtEnd)->equals(toCSSStepsTimingFunctionValue(*timingFunctionValue.get()))); |
| |
| timingFunctionValue = BisonCSSParser::parseAnimationTimingFunctionValue("steps(3, nowhere)"); |
| EXPECT_EQ(0, timingFunctionValue.get()); |
| |
| timingFunctionValue = BisonCSSParser::parseAnimationTimingFunctionValue("steps(-3, end)"); |
| EXPECT_EQ(0, timingFunctionValue.get()); |
| |
| timingFunctionValue = BisonCSSParser::parseAnimationTimingFunctionValue("steps(3)"); |
| EXPECT_TRUE(CSSStepsTimingFunctionValue::create(3, StepsTimingFunction::StepAtEnd)->equals(toCSSStepsTimingFunctionValue(*timingFunctionValue.get()))); |
| |
| timingFunctionValue = BisonCSSParser::parseAnimationTimingFunctionValue("cubic-bezier(0.1, 5, 0.23, 0)"); |
| EXPECT_TRUE(CSSCubicBezierTimingFunctionValue::create(0.1, 5, 0.23, 0)->equals(toCSSCubicBezierTimingFunctionValue(*timingFunctionValue.get()))); |
| |
| timingFunctionValue = BisonCSSParser::parseAnimationTimingFunctionValue("cubic-bezier(0.1, 0, 4, 0.4)"); |
| EXPECT_EQ(0, timingFunctionValue.get()); |
| } |
